Cell Organelles & Structures: Before the Bell Biology
<p>Time before the bell to try 9 questions on cell organelles and structures? Organelles/structures that are listed here include nucleus, mitochondrion, chloroplast, cell membrane, ribosome, ER, golgi apparatus, vacuole, cytoplasm, and more plus the words prokaryotic and eukaryotic are mentioned! You'll also get answers complete with illustrations and explanations while music plays in the background. The progress bar has divisions in the video to make it easy to skip ahead to another question if you need to move faster, and all questions/explanations are on screen if you prefer to mute the music.</p>
